Brooklyn is a suburb of Wellington, the capital city of New Zealand. It is located three km south of the city centre, on the eastern slopes of the hills above Happy Valley, which extend south towards the Owhiro Bay on Cook Strait. Excellent views across the southern end of the city can be gained from the suburb. Cook Strait It is named after the borough of New York City, and many of the streets are named after former US Presidents:
- Grover Cleveland — Cleveland Street
- Calvin Coolidge — Coolidge Street
- James Garfield — Garfield Street
- William Henry Harrison — Harrison Street
- Herbert Hoover — Hoover Street
- Thomas Jefferson — Jefferson Street
- Abraham Lincoln — Lincoln Street
- William McKinley — McKinley Crescent
- William Taft — Taft Street
- George Washington — Washington Avenue Heaton Terrace is named after John Henry Heaton, a member of the early Harbour Board. Interestingly, the nearby suburb of Kingston has Canadian-themed names. category: Wellington urban districts
